How they compare
Rhône-Alpes (NUTS 2013) currently reports 730,710 against 492,630 in Lithuania, a difference of 238,080.
That makes Rhône-Alpes (NUTS 2013)'s figure about 1.5 times Lithuania's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 5 shared years of data; in 2005 it was Lithuania ahead.
Lithuania ranks 21st and Rhône-Alpes (NUTS 2013) ranks 18th of 28 countries.
Rhône-Alpes (NUTS 2013) has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Lithuania | Rhône-Alpes (NUTS 2013) |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 704,280 | 724,440 | 20,160 | Rhône-Alpes (NUTS 2013) |
| 2010s | 564,100 | 741,303 | 177,203 | Rhône-Alpes (NUTS 2013) |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
